搭建高效稳定的大型云存储服务器,从规划到优化
搭建高效稳定的大型云存储服务器需要从规划、架构设计、硬件选型、软件配置、性能优化和安全性等多个方面进行全面考虑,规划阶段需明确存储需求、扩展性和成本预算;架构设计应选择合适的存储解决方案,如分布式存储或对象存储;硬件选型需考虑存储容量、性能和可靠性;软件配置需优化文件系统、负载均衡和数据冗余;性能优化包括带宽管理、缓存机制和数据压缩;安全性则需加强访问控制、数据加密和备份策略,通过系统化的规划和优化,可实现高效、稳定、安全的云存储服务。
大型云存储服务器的重要性
在数字化时代,数据被视为企业的核心资产,大型云存储服务器能够为企业提供海量数据的存储、管理和访问能力,支持业务的持续增长,以下是搭建大型云存储服务器的几个关键优势:
- 高可用性:通过分布式存储架构和冗余设计,确保数据的高可用性和可靠性,避免因硬件故障导致的数据丢失或服务中断。
- 可扩展性:支持横向扩展,能够根据业务需求灵活增加存储容量和性能,满足企业未来发展的需求。
- 高效访问:通过优化数据读写性能和网络传输效率,提升用户对数据的访问体验。
- 安全性:通过数据加密、访问控制和多副本机制,保障数据的安全性,防止数据泄露或被恶意攻击。
技术选型:选择适合的存储架构
搭建大型云存储服务器的第一步是选择合适的存储架构,主流的存储架构包括分布式存储、对象存储、块存储等,以下是几种常见架构的特点和适用场景:
分布式存储系统
分布式存储系统通过将数据分散存储在多台服务器上,实现高可用性和高扩展性,常见的分布式存储系统包括Hadoop HDFS、Ceph、GlusterFS等,这类系统适合需要处理海量非结构化数据的企业,例如视频存储、日志分析等。
对象存储
对象存储是一种基于云的存储方式,适合存储大量非结构化数据,如图片、视频、文档等,对象存储的特点是高扩展性、高可用性和低延迟,适合需要频繁访问和管理海量数据的场景。
块存储
块存储是一种传统的存储方式,适合需要高性能和低延迟的场景,例如数据库、虚拟化等,块存储的优势在于能够提供快速的数据读写能力,但扩展性相对较弱。
在选择存储架构时,需要综合考虑企业的业务需求、数据类型、预算和未来扩展性等因素。
架构设计:构建高可用、可扩展的存储系统
一个优秀的大型云存储服务器架构需要兼顾高可用性、可扩展性和安全性,以下是架构设计的关键点:
高可用性设计
- 冗余设计:通过多副本机制或RAID技术,确保数据的冗余存储,避免因单点故障导致数据丢失。
- 负载均衡:通过负载均衡技术,将数据请求均匀分配到多台服务器上,提升整体性能和可用性。
- 容灾备份:通过异地备份和容灾方案,确保在发生灾难性事件时能够快速恢复数据和服务。
可扩展性设计
- 横向扩展:通过增加服务器节点,提升存储容量和性能,满足业务增长的需求。
- 弹性扩展:支持动态调整存储资源,根据业务负载的变化自动扩展或收缩资源。
安全性设计
- 数据加密:对存储的数据进行加密,防止数据在传输和存储过程中被窃取。
- 访问控制:通过细粒度的权限管理,确保只有授权用户能够访问敏感数据。
- 监控与审计:通过实时监控和日志审计,及时发现和应对潜在的安全威胁。
实施步骤:从规划到上线
搭建大型云存储服务器需要经过多个阶段,每个阶段都需要精心规划和实施。
规划阶段
- 需求分析:明确企业的存储需求,包括存储容量、性能要求、数据类型等。
- 技术选型:根据需求选择合适的存储架构和工具。
- 资源规划:估算所需的硬件资源,包括服务器、存储设备、网络设备等。
部署阶段
- 硬件部署:安装和配置服务器、存储设备和网络设备。
- 软件部署:安装和配置存储系统软件,如分布式存储系统、对象存储系统等。
- 集成测试:对存储系统进行功能测试和性能测试,确保系统稳定运行。
测试与优化
- 压力测试:模拟高负载场景,测试系统的性能和稳定性。
- 性能优化:根据测试结果,优化存储系统的配置和参数,提升性能和效率。
上线与运维
- 系统上线:将存储系统正式投入使用,确保业务的平稳运行。
- 持续运维:通过监控和维护,确保系统的长期稳定性和安全性。
优化建议:提升存储系统的性能与效率
在搭建大型云存储服务器后,可以通过以下优化措施进一步提升系统的性能和效率:
性能优化
- 缓存机制:通过引入缓存技术,减少对存储系统的直接访问压力。
- 数据压缩与去重:通过数据压缩和去重技术,减少存储空间的占用。
成本优化
- 选择合适的存储类型:根据数据的访问频率和重要性,选择合适的存储类型,如热存储、冷存储等。
- 自动化管理:通过自动化工具,优化存储资源的使用效率,降低运维成本。
安全性优化
- 多因素认证:通过多因素认证机制,提升系统的安全性。
- 定期备份:定期进行数据备份,确保数据的可恢复性。
未来趋势:云存储技术的发展方向
随着技术的不断进步,云存储技术也在不断发展,以下是未来云存储技术的几个发展方向:
- 云原生存储:通过云原生技术,提升存储系统的灵活性和可扩展性。
- 边缘计算与存储:通过边缘计算技术,将存储能力延伸到边缘节点,提升数据处理的效率。
- AI与大数据结合:通过AI技术,优化存储系统的性能和管理效率,提升数据的价值。
扫描二维码推送至手机访问。
版权声明:本文由必安云计算发布,如需转载请注明出处。
本文链接:https://www.bayidc.com/article/index.php/post/41829.html